Transaction efbf59a8b4d063a4da8012d9d2f4ad2c22a5ae817c0f5988c52de59f90c0a680

1 Input
2 Outputs
  • efbf59a8b4d063a4da8012d9d2f4ad2c22a5ae817c0f5988c52de59f90c0a680:0
  • value  20210
    address  3H6e7MXPsmRd9EXutHKYdsrKnAfX3T1arE
  • efbf59a8b4d063a4da8012d9d2f4ad2c22a5ae817c0f5988c52de59f90c0a680:1
  • value  102266401
    address  3F3Ma8HBxCC1hPTbaooa97D1f2tDSui33j